Oil Massage: Benefits, Techniques, and Tips

Oil massage, also known as Abhyanga in Ayurvedic tradition, is a therapeutic practice that has been cherished for centuries. This ancient technique involves the application of warm oil to the body, followed by a series of massage strokes designed to promote relaxation, improve circulation, and enhance overall well-being. In this comprehensive guide, we will explore the myriad benefits of oil massage, delve into various techniques, and provide practical tips to help you make the most of this rejuvenating experience.

Benefits of Oil Massage

  • Relaxation and Stress Relief One of the most immediate and noticeable benefits of oil massage is its ability to induce deep relaxation. The soothing touch of warm oil combined with gentle massage strokes helps to calm the nervous system, reduce stress hormones, and promote a sense of tranquility. This relaxation response can be particularly beneficial for individuals dealing with anxiety, insomnia, or chronic stress.
  • Improved Circulation Oil massage stimulates blood flow, which can help to oxygenate tissues and remove metabolic waste products. Improved circulation also supports the delivery of essential nutrients to cells, promoting overall health and vitality. This increased blood flow can be especially beneficial for individuals with poor circulation or those recovering from injury.
  • Enhanced Skin Health The application of oil during a massage not only nourishes the skin but also helps to improve its texture and appearance. Oils such as coconut, sesame, and almond are rich in vitamins and antioxidants that can hydrate the skin, reduce inflammation, and protect against environmental damage. Regular oil massage can leave your skin feeling soft, supple, and radiant.
  • Pain Relief Oil massage can be an effective natural remedy for various types of pain, including muscle soreness, joint pain, and headaches. The combination of warm oil and massage techniques helps to relax tense muscles, reduce inflammation, and alleviate discomfort. This makes oil massage a valuable tool for individuals with conditions such as arthritis, fibromyalgia, or sports injuries.
  • Detoxification The practice of oil massage can support the body’s natural detoxification processes. By stimulating the lymphatic system, oil massage helps to remove toxins and waste products from the body. This detoxifying effect can boost the immune system, improve digestion, and enhance overall health.

Techniques of Oil Massage

  • Effleurage Effleurage is a gentle, gliding stroke that is often used at the beginning and end of a massage session. This technique involves using the palms of the hands to apply long, sweeping strokes along the length of the body. Effleurage helps to warm up the muscles, improve circulation, and promote relaxation.
  • Petrissage Petrissage involves kneading, rolling, and squeezing the muscles to release tension and improve flexibility. This technique is particularly effective for targeting deeper layers of muscle tissue and breaking down adhesions. Petrissage can be performed using the hands, fingers, or knuckles.
  • Friction Friction is a more intense technique that involves applying deep, circular pressure to specific areas of the body. This technique is used to break down scar tissue, release muscle knots, and improve range of motion. Friction is often used in combination with other massage techniques to address specific problem areas.
  • Tapotement Tapotement, also known as percussion, involves rhythmic tapping or striking of the body using the hands or fingers. This technique can help to stimulate the nervous system, improve muscle tone, and increase circulation. Tapotement is often used in sports massage to invigorate the muscles and prepare them for activity.
  • Vibration Vibration involves rapid shaking or trembling movements that are applied to specific areas of the body. This technique can help to relax muscles, reduce pain, and improve circulation. Vibration is often used in combination with other massage techniques to enhance their effects.

Tips for a Successful Oil Massage

  • Choose the Right Oil Selecting the right oil is crucial for a successful massage experience. Different oils have unique properties and benefits, so it’s important to choose one that suits your needs. For example, coconut oil is known for its moisturizing and anti-inflammatory properties, while sesame oil is prized for its warming and detoxifying effects.
  • Create a Relaxing Environment The environment in which you receive or give a massage can greatly impact its effectiveness. To create a calming atmosphere, consider dimming the lights, playing soothing music, and using aromatherapy diffusers with essential oils such as lavender or chamomile.
  • Warm the Oil Warming the oil before applying it to the body can enhance its therapeutic effects. You can warm the oil by placing the bottle in a bowl of hot water or using a specialized oil warmer. Be sure to test the temperature of the oil on your wrist before applying it to ensure it is not too hot.
  • Communicate with Your Massage Therapist Communication is key to a successful massage experience. Be sure to inform your massage therapist of any specific areas of tension, pain, or discomfort you may have. This will allow them to tailor the massage to your needs and ensure you receive the maximum benefit.
  • Hydrate After the Massage Drinking plenty of water after a massage can help to flush out toxins and support the body’s natural healing processes. Hydration is especially important after a deep tissue massage, as it can help to reduce muscle soreness and promote recovery.
